|| Alphabetizing rules is a BAD idea. Rules run in the order they are
|| created. Alphabetizing them defeats the purpose of having rules run
|| in a certain order. The rule to delete anything from xyz@xxxxxxx
|| would run at the end of your rules where the rule to move anything
|| from *@abc.com would run first and take that email out of your inbox
|| so your later rule would never run on it.
||
|| Create fewer rules. I have been running Outlook for almost 10 years
|| and have less than 25 rules that handle ALL of my emails.
